Redundancy isn’t just for airlines. A reliable answering service uses multiple data centers, backup power, and call routing paths. If one system fails, calls seamlessly transfer to another, so interruptions don’t reach your clients.
These systems can dramatically reduce your risk of downtime. With the right provider, your customers may not even realize you’re having a technical hiccup.

AI doesn’t just record a caller’s message—it makes it useful. As soon as someone leaves a voicemail, the system transcribes it into text. This means you can glance at your phone or computer and know what the inquiry’s about, even in noisy places or meetings, without ever playing the audio.
Managing your messages shouldn’t feel like digging for old emails. With AI, voicemails and text messages are all stored neatly in one place—easy to sort, review, and track. You get notified instantly through your preferred channel, so urgent calls come straight to you. Need to forward a message to a team member? A couple of clicks is all it takes.

A Newark answering service is a team or AI system that answers your business calls for you, day or night. They can take messages, schedule appointments, and answer questions, so you never miss an important call—even after hours or during busy times.
An answering service keeps your business open 24/7. This means customers can reach you during evenings, weekends, or holidays. If something urgent happens, your callers will always get a real response, not just a voicemail.
Most answering services are trained to sound just like your own staff. They follow your instructions and use your company’s greeting, so callers usually can’t tell the difference.
